摘要
The deposition of amyloid-β (Aβ) plaques and tau-based neurofibrillary tangles is a neuropathological feature of Alzheimer's disease (AD). While studies have shown that the Aβ and tau interaction results in elevated AD pathology, the molecular linkage and mechanism of interaction of Aβ and tau are unclear. A recent study demonstrated the direct interaction between the Aβ core and specific regions of tau that facilitates pathological cross-seeding via a shared epitope. The data suggest that targeting the common epitope could be a more effective treatment strategy rather than targeting only Aβ or only tau. The findings have an important clinical significance for AD and related tauopathies.
